Semiconductor Stocks Face Pressure Amid AI Concerns and Economic Data Watch
17.02.2026 - 22:41:03 | boerse-global.de
A broader sell-off in the semiconductor sector weighed on shares of Intel (INTC) this week, with the stock declining approximately 1.4% during Tuesday’s trading session. The weakness appears driven more by sector-wide apprehension than by company-specific issues, with investor focus fixed on the sustainability of the artificial intelligence boom and upcoming key economic indicators.
Market participants are closely monitoring two imminent data releases. The primary focus is on the Personal Consumption Expenditures (PCE) price index due Friday, which serves as the Federal Reserve’s preferred gauge of inflation.
